Transaction 3bda1a1a45fe195c7b61c027c1c9304b301a2e4682983669afaf07fd74923bb3
1 Input
1 Output
-
3bda1a1a45fe195c7b61c027c1c9304b301a2e4682983669afaf07fd74923bb3:0
- value
- 517895
- script pubkey
- OP_0 OP_PUSHBYTES_20 e3c315363920efd7e3e1cc2643f6331cca7a866d
- address
- bc1qu0p32d3eyrha0clpesny8a3nrn984pnd9u9scg